Predicted Barcelona Line-up To Face Sevilla In La Liga

Barcelona will look to take a step closer to the La Liga title when they take on Sevilla at the Ramon Sanchez Pizjuan on Saturday night.  

The Catalans sit on top of the table with 75 points from 29 games, with an 11-point advantage over second-placed Atletico Madrid. A win over Vincenzo Montella’s side this weekend could possibly see them widen the gap at the top to 14 points, given that the Rojiblancos are scheduled to play a day later.

Probable Barcelona XI

Manager: Ernesto Valverde

Formation: 4-4-2

Jasper Cillesen (GK)

The Netherlands international has been extensively used in the cup competitions this season. But an injury to Ter Stegen means he could get an opportunity in this league game.

Sergi Roberto (RB)

The academy graduate has made the right-back spot his own ahead of summer signing Nelson Semedo. His forward forays down the right flank will be key.  

Gerard Pique (CB)

The defender has emerged as a leader on the field for the Blaugrana this term. His experience and know-how are pivotal for the team.

Samuel Umtiti (CB)

The France international is enjoying a fine campaign with the Catalans and has established himself as one of the best in Europe.  

Jordi Alba (LB)

After a below par campaign last time out, Spanish left-back Jordi Alba has been brilliant this season. His attacking intent and influence from the left-hand side have been crucial in Barcelona’s strong season so far.  

Ousmane Dembele (RW)

The France international has shown glimpses of his immense potential in his first season at the Camp Nou. Will be hoping to finish the season strongly.  

Paulinho (CM)

Contrary to initial expectations, former Tottenham Hotspur man Paulinho has been a revelation since his summer move from China. Should start this game.

Ivan Rakitic (CM)

The Croatian international led his team to a victory over Mexico during the international break and will be keen on performing well for his club as well.

Andres Iniesta (LW)

The Spanish pass maestro might be in the twilight of his career but he still remains an important cog in the wheel for Barcelona.  

Luis Suarez (ST)

With 21 goals and 6 assists from 25 La Liga outings, Luis Suarez will be a major threat to the Sevilla defence when the two sides meet.

Lionel Messi (ST)

There were concerns over his fitness following his absence for Argentina during the international break. However, having trained with the squad on Thursday, the little magician will look to boost his tally of 35 goals and 16 assists for the season, when Barcelona take on Sevilla.
